Do not operate the device in a very damp environment or in the
vicinity of combustible material.
Immediately after ironing, place the still hot device down a mini-
mum distance of 15 cm away from walls, furniture and other
objects.
Always check the device for damage before putting it into op-
eration. Only use the device if it along with the mains cable and
plug have no signs of damage!
In the event of damage/faults, switch the device off immediately.
Do not make any changes to the device. Also do not replace
the mains cable yourself. Only ever have repairs to the device,
cable and plug carried out in a specialist workshop. Contact
the customer service department if necessary. Incorrect repairs
may pose considerable risks to the user.
Be aware of damage caused by re! Never iron on one spot for
too long. Never leave the hot bottom of the iron standing on the
fabric or another heat-sensitive surface!
Avoiding Damage to Material, Property and the Device
Make sure that the mains cable is not squashed, bent or laid
over sharp edges and does not come into contact with hot sur-
faces.
Only iron on a stable, at, heat-resistant and moisture-resistant
surface. We recommend that you use a standard ironing board.
Do not iron on surfaces made from glass or plastic.
Always work with suf cient lighting.
Never exceed the maximum ll level (note MAX marking on the
water reservoir!). If possible, only ll the device with distilled
water.
Never pour any descaling or cleaning agent or other chemical
additives into the device. This may destroy the device and safe
working is no longer guaranteed.
Open the water reservoir cover only to ll the water reservoir.
Otherwise keep the cover closed while operating the iron.
Never cover up the steam nozzles and do not stick any objects
into them.
